Diff Mining: Logit Differences Reveal Finetuning Objectives
Quick summary
arXiv:2608.26462v1 Announce Type: cross Abstract: Finetuning has become the gold standard for refining existing behaviors and inducing new ones in language models, yet it often remains unclear exactly which behaviors emerge during this process. As models grow ever more capable, understanding finetuning better becomes increasingly important, particularly since unwanted behaviors may arise during finetuning.
